How much solar power does Japan have?By the end of 2017, cumulative capacity reached 50 GW, the world's second largest solar PV installed capacity, behind China. In line with the significant rise in installations and capacity, solar power accounted for 9.9% of Japan's national electricity generation in 2022, up from 0.3% in 2010.
How will Japan expand solar power?The Japanese government is seeking to expand solar power by enacting subsidies and a feed-in tariff (FIT). In December 2008, the Ministry of Economy, Trade and Industry announced a goal of 70% of new homes having solar power installed, and would be spending $145 million in the first quarter of 2009 to encourage home solar power.
How much solar power will Japan need by 2021?As of July 2021, Japan was aiming at 108 GW of solar capacity by 2030. In May 2021, the Japanese Trade Ministry said that Japan may require up to 370 GW of solar capacity by 2050 to reach the goal of cutting carbon emissions to zero.
Why is solar energy important in Japan?Solar energy dominates Japan's renewable energy landscape, holding approximately 56% of the total installed capacity in 2024. The segment's prominence is driven by significant utility-scale solar energy PV market developments and supportive government policies.
Is solar energy cost-effective in Japan?The improved cost-effectiveness is particularly evident in the solar photovoltaic sector, where Japan has established itself as a global leader with 45% of photovoltaic cells manufactured domestically.
